Relaxing Day in Hyderabad, India

Itinerary

8:00 AM: Start your day at the beautiful hotel of your choice in Hyderabad.

Enjoy a leisurely breakfast at the hotel and take some time to relax and prepare for a day of relaxation in Hyderabad.

10:00 AM: Visit the serene Lumbini Park (Free admission, 2 hours).

Lumbini Park is a peaceful urban park located on the banks of the Hussain Sagar Lake. Take a stroll through the park, enjoy the lush greenery, and relax by the lake. You can also take a boat ride to the famous Buddha Statue located in the middle of the lake.

12:30 PM: Indulge in a traditional Hyderabadi lunch at Paradise Biriyani (Approx. ₹500 per person, 1 hour).

Paradise Biriyani is a popular restaurant in Hyderabad known for its delicious biryanis. Experience the rich flavors of Hyderabadi cuisine and savor the aromatic rice dish paired with mouth-watering delicacies.

2:00 PM: Pamper yourself with a relaxing massage at Kairali Ayurvedic Centre (Approx. ₹2000, 2 hours).

Escape the hustle and bustle of the city and rejuvenate your body and mind at the Kairali Ayurvedic Centre. Enjoy a traditional Ayurvedic massage and experience holistic healing techniques that will leave you feeling refreshed and relaxed.

4:30 PM: Explore the Salar Jung Museum (Approx. ₹100 per person, 2 hours).

Visit one of the largest art museums in the world, the Salar Jung Museum, which houses an extensive collection of art, sculptures, manuscripts, and decorative arts. Take your time to admire the intricate craftsmanship and learn about the rich history and culture of India.

7:00 PM: Enjoy a sunset boat ride on Hussain Sagar Lake (Approx. ₹200 per person, 1 hour).

Take in the breathtaking views of the sunset as you sail across the picturesque Hussain Sagar Lake. Admire the iconic Buddha Statue and enjoy the peaceful ambiance of the lake before heading back to the hotel.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a more off the beaten path experience, consider visiting the Chilkur Balaji Temple. This temple is believed to fulfill devotees' wishes, and visitors can participate in a unique tradition of making 108 pradakshinas (circumambulations) around the temple for good luck. The serene atmosphere and spiritual aura make it a favorite among locals seeking solace and relaxation.

Another local favorite is the Qutb Shahi Tombs, a tranquil complex housing the tombs of the Qutb Shahi dynasty. Explore the beautifully preserved tombs surrounded by lush gardens and soak in the history and architectural splendor of this hidden gem.
